Fresh & inviting Munich abode with elegant interiors
LOUIS Hotel Munich, Germany





Property details
- Exciting city break: With a central location in the heart of surprising Munich, LOUIS Hotel Munich is an elegant pad with buckets of style and character. Housed in an imposing white building around the corner from the historic Peterskirche, your sightseeing sojourn begins the moment you check in.
- Delectable dining options: Boasting views of the Viktualienmarkt, enjoy a healthy breakfast and fine coffee in the breakfast room. Elsewhere, the Grill Room is a sophisticated, wood-panelled space specialising in meat and vegetarian dishes expertly prepared on the grill. Round off your evening with a nightcap at The Sparkling Bar which, as its name suggests, has a variety of sparkling wines, proseccos, and champagnes to choose from.
- Abundance of flair: They say the devil’s in the detail, and the guest rooms at LOUIS have been designed with utmost care. You’ll find handmade pieces of furniture crafted from walnut and oak, natural stone accents and tiling reminiscent of Parisian romance. There’s a stylish ensuite, as well as a French balcony that overlooks the leafy inner courtyard, St. Peter’s Church, or the Viktualienmarkt itself.
How to get there
LOUIS Hotel Munich is approximately 40 kilometres away from Munich airport. You can drive, however it’s super easy to reach the hotel on the S-bahn. Simply take the S1 from the airport to Marienplatz; from there, it’s a two-minute walk to the hotel.
